What to look out for when choosing a family holiday

If you are planning a family holiday there are a few things that you should look out for so to ensure you get the most out of your holiday and that everyone has fun. Here are some things to consider before booking;

Time of year

It probably seems obvious but consider the time of year you are going. You may have got a really cheap deal that seems too good to be true but when you get there every major attraction is closed. Depending on your holiday destination, some of the major attractions may not be open if you choose to go out of peak season.

Some towns and cities rely heavily on tourism and as such put all their efforts and money into making the holiday season great fun and entertainment for all. Visiting during the months of May-August will ensure you get the best of the entertainment, however, visiting outside these months may mean the area is quiet with little to do.

Consider going with friends

If you know another family that have children then consider going with them as well. You may find that discounts are available for group bookings and it will also mean the children have friends there to play with, leaving you more time to relax without entertaining them yourself.

Going with friends also means you can share the babysitting duties which can be stressful and exhausting. It is recommended that you get separate accommodation but if you get on really well with the other family there is no reason why you can’t all share.

Things to do

There must be plenty to do, especially for the children. Swimming pools are a must have as they are great fun, due to the weather in-door swimming pools are probably going to be found more commonly but if the pool is outdoor then make sure it is heated. A play area or kids club for the children is really important to entertain them and give you some time to yourself.

Ensure all areas of the resort are well secure with lifeguards around the swimming pool and fully trained employees in charge of the kids club. This will give you the peace of mind required to enjoy your break.

Holiday parks are a great option with plenty for the kids to do during the day and great shows from leading performers for everyone to enjoy at night.
